Unit 1 • Investigation V
Model 1: IONIC Properties: Made of metal and non-metal atomsDissolves in waterConducts electricity when dissolved but
not when solidBrittle solidsDescription of drawing: Spheres without
gray areas represent metal atoms. Spheres with gray areas are non-metal atoms. Metal atoms “give up” their valence electrons to non-metal atoms.

Unit 1 • Investigation V
Model 2: COVALENT NETWORKProperties:Made entirely of nonmetal atomsDoes not dissolve in waterDoes not conduct electricityVery hard solidsDescription of drawing: Valence
electrons connect atoms with each other in all directions – like a grid or network. (cont.)

Unit 1 • Investigation V
Model 3: METALLICProperties:Made entirely of metal atomsDo not dissolve in waterConduct electricityBendable solidsDescription of drawing: Valence
electrons are free to move throughout the substance like a “sea” of electrons.

Unit 1 • Investigation V
Model 4: MOLECULAR COVALENTProperties:Made of nonmetal atomsSome dissolve in water, some do notDo not conduct electricityTend to be liquids or gases or softer
solidsDescription of drawing: Valence
electrons are shared between some atoms. This creates small stable units within the substance. (cont.)
